4 Helpful Tips to Obtain Commercial Air Conditioning

Nowadays, every office has air conditioning of some or the other type. The same holds true for various other commercial establishments such as supermarkets and shopping malls. Furthermore, the transit vehicles we use such as cars and buses too have the provision of AC. This has certainly made us habituated or rather dependent on AC even at our homes.

However, it is extremely confusing to shop for home air conditioning, office air conditioning or commercial air conditioning as there are so many options and variables to consider. Given below are a few tips to choose best air conditioning by taking into account certain factors. Take a look at them and get a better idea.

1. Among the air conditioners available in the market, Split AC and window AC are the most popular for home air conditioning and even commercial air conditioning for that matter. They are extensively used at offices and commercial places as well. However, people nowadays mostly opt for Split AC, which comes in a set of two units- indoor and outdoor. They make less noise and are flexible to fit at windows than Windows AC by electrician in Melbourne. Once it is decided which one of these will you opt for, you will have to look at other considerations.

2. You can’t ignore the size of your room. Make sure that you prefer AC that suits the dimensions of your room. If you opt for a bigger AC in your small room, you are likely to feel too much cold. This will lead to unnecessary power consumption and thus, more electricity bills. If you go for a small AC in a big room, there will be no proper cooling effect and hence leaving you frustrated. This holds true for commercial air conditioning or office air conditioning as well. 

3. Fix your budget. Do not overspend and then repent the financial decision for the rest of your life. It is advisable to opt for AC within your budget constraints. Obviously, your budget, needs and convenience will help you to decide what type of AC you would prefer. If you want to opt for economical one, choose with the basic features such as tonnage, fan speed, service etc. Then you can opt for a brand model suitable for home use.

4. Choose a reputed store to buy the AC. Also, make it a point to ask the shop owner for an expert electrician in Melbourne to fit the AC. Make sure to select the unit, which comes with a long term manufacturer’s warranty. It will give the full replacement policy for a specified period.

Top 5 Benefits of Split Air Conditioner

Air conditioners are an important house hold appliance that helps to keep your indoors cosy and comfortable.  Customers are spoilt with the plethora of choices available in the market. Split air conditioner is one of the preferred options among the house owners because of its varied range of benefits. Also known as ‘wall hung head unit’, this system is split up into indoor and outdoor components. 

Below listed are the main advantages of split systems over the ducted air conditioning. Click here to find detailed specifications and features of different air conditioners. Go ahead and take a look at the following points to get a better perspective. 

1. Since there are no duct works involved, it is an easy job to set up the air conditioning system in any space, no matter whether it is a residential or commercial setting.

2. It is easier to maintain the functioning and performance of split systems which saves your money on air conditioning repair.

3. Buildings with space constraints can reap the benefits of having a split style AC as there is only a single outdoor device. Moreover, its sleek design will blend with any decor style seamlessly.

4. Zoning is available with the split systems which give you the benefit of controlling the temperature of each room separately.

5. More than saving money on your initial investment of purchasing an air conditioner, split style AC also help you to save on your energy bills.

How to Choose the Right Size of Ducted Air Conditioning System for Your Home?

Buying a heating and cooling system for your home is a shrewd investment made with a long-term vision. However, frequent repairs or replacements can put you in trouble that pours your money down the drain. There can be several reasons for the substandard performance or frequent breakdowns of your split air conditioner. One of the most common reasons is choosing the rights size during the purchase.

Consider you have bought an AC that is too small for your home, it have to function beyond its threshold levels to reach the desired temperatures. What could be the result? Sooner or often, you have to take it an air conditioning repair technician for fixing the noise issues or break down. On the contrary, if you have purchased an AC that is too big, be ready to get a shock from the electricity bills. Larger ducted air conditioning systems will draw energy and power more than necessary, which will result in the higher energy bills. Hence, making a right pick is essential.

Check your home’s location, amount to shade you get, number of window and doors before buying the air conditioners. Is there any insulation material that may affect the efficiency of AC units? Moreover, consider the number of family members and cooling needs, which will let you decide the zoning demands.
